ALQUERIA BLANCA

A charming town, full of history and corners where the passage of time has stopped. Alquería Blanca is part of the municipality of Santanyí, which is less than five minutes away by car.

Strolling through its streets, enjoying the hustle and bustle of the town square, meeting its people and feeling the energy that this small but wonderful town gives off is essential.

The name "Alquería Blanca" comes from Arabic, from when the islands were occupied by Muslims until 1229 and means country house dedicated to work, away from the towns.

Alquería Blanca was a strategic point for piracy in the south of the archipelago, it served as surveillance and warning when attacks were suffered in the southern part of the island.

Although in the beginning it was not recorded as a settlement, it was not until 1641 when the "Monasterio de la Mare de Deu de la Consolación" was built on top of a hill, since piracy was no longer a serious problem in the area and the family Rigo de Can Timoner settled at the foot of the monastery and began to dedicate to agriculture, especially the cultivation of cereals.

Nowadays, visiting the Mare de Deu de la Consolació Monastery in the town is practically mandatory, it is not difficult to fall in love with the place, as it has spectacular and exclusive views from where you can see the entire Southeast of the island. In addition, from there you can do countless hiking trails.

In Alquería Blanca, you can enjoy local cuisine and traditions. The town square is the heart of Alquería Blanca, the nerve center. There, every Tuesday the weekly market is held, also in its surroundings there are several bars and restaurants, without forgetting the different ovens and traditional pastry shops, of special mention is "Can Terrasa" famous for its ensaïmadas, without a doubt an irresistible pleasure that can only be can find here.
